WebNov 10, 2024 · Use a graphing utility to confirm your results. Solution To determine concavity, we need to find the second derivative f ″ (x). The first derivative is f ′ (x) = 3x2 − 12x + 9, so the second derivative is f ″ (x) = 6x − 12. If the function changes concavity, it occurs either when f ″ (x) = 0 or f ″ (x) is undefined. It plots your function in … WebExample: Graph the derivative of f (x)=x 3 • Press [Y=] • Press [MATH] • Press [8] to select 8:nDeriv ( • Press [X,T,θ,n] [^] [3] [,] [X,T,θ,n] [,] [X,T,θ,n] [)] [ENTER] • Press [GRAPH] to view the derivative graph. Please see the TI-83 Plus guidebook for additional information. WebGraphing the Derivative In our previous example, we used the definition for the derivative to find the derivative of the function y = x2. When we did this, we found the derivative to be a function itself: dy/dx = 2x.
